Virulence Factors, Capsular Serotypes and Antimicrobial Resistance of Hypervirulent <i>Klebsiella pneumoniae</i> and Classical <i>Klebsiella pneumoniae</i> in Southeast Iran

The frequency of hvKP was low, but overall, the prevalence of virulence-related genes was higher in hvKP than cKP. HvKP was not related to specific serotypes. Furthermore, hvKP isolates were more susceptible to antimicrobial agents compared to cKP isolates.
